A specialist MSc in the design and analysis of advanced lightweight and composite structures for application in aerospace, automotive, motorsport, marine and renewable energy industries. The course covers key topics in composite structural design and analysis, impact and crashworthiness, materials characterisation and failure and advanced simulation.Delivered with a unique focus on industry challenges and concerns, this course will equip you with strong experimental, numerical and analytical skills in structural mechanics for both composite and metallic components. This will help you to practically apply this knowledge to solve real engineering problems including automotive and aircraft structural design through to lightweight composites for use in wind turbines. Established in 2003 this postgraduate course has double accreditations with the Institute of Mechanical Engineering and the Royal Aeronautical Society, graduates secure exciting roles with globally renowned companies around the world.
